Rowlands Castle Woman Jailed for Shoplifting Spree

A 40-year-old woman from Rowlands Castle has been slammed with a five-month prison sentence for shoplifting in Havant and Fareham.

Natalie Murphy Caught Stealing Twice

Natalie Murphy, from Whichers Gate Road, admitted guilt to two separate thefts. The first hit happened on December 31, 2020, at Sainsbury’s Broadcut in Fareham, where she swiped over £400 worth of goods.

Her second theft took place this July at the Asda store on Purbrook Way, where she pinched more than £300 in items.

Justice Served at Portsmouth Magistrates Court

On Wednesday, 15 September, Portsmouth Magistrates handed down Murphy’s sentence after hearing all the facts. She now faces five months behind bars for her shoplifting offences.
